论Java和C++方向选择

目录

1.难度

Java ,C++, 测开,整体来说三个方向难度相当。

1.仅从语法角度来看,c++ 是掌控一切,知识都要懂一点,而java的特点在于省心,都封装好了。

2.这三个方向都需要学习,数据结构,操作系统,网络编程,数据库等。基本知识差不太多。

3.java 后期是JavaEE(Spring 系列框架),这是相对比较难的。

4.测开大部分和Java方向一样,只是后面学测试理论,和测试工具代替了Spring 难度稍比差一丢丢。

总的来说,三个方向难度无高低,高薪就意味着高门槛!!!

2.就业压力

在校招中,c++,Java ,测开的就业岗位数量相当。

在社招中,招Java的多些。
总的来说应聘人数Java开发 > c++开发 > 测试开发。

Java开发就业压力大些,内卷的更厉害些。

3.岗位选择

校招中一般要求掌握一门主流编程语言即可。c++/Java都可以!
很多公司在招聘的时候并不会直接写语言,而只是写 后台开发工程师 和 软件开发工程师。具体看公司岗位的安排,那里有空缺就安排到哪。
所以自己学的Java 或 C++方向,到头来到工作中都不会用到。
所以我们现在学的是一种方法,不断锻炼我们的能力,学习的过程。

4.薪资待遇

C++开发,java开发和测试开发都是技术岗,薪资待遇都是同一级别的。

在校招中,能拿多少薪资和公司水平以及自己的面试表示直接相关 ,和应聘的岗位关系不大。

对于大厂来说,这几个岗位的薪资都是一样的。

对于中小厂来说测开可能会和开发持平,也有可能略低1-2K。但是随着工作年限的提升,中间差别就会逐渐磨平。

5.选择建议

喜欢做东西,快速搭建网站,应用选 Java
游戏,嵌入式,考研(考研资料大部分都是C++) C++

大一,大二的学生 未来有考研的打算,那就大一大二好好学习技术

大三开学的时候就一定要确定是就业还是考研
确定一个后就努力去实现。
考研:专业课就有底子了,考上的概率就大写,失败了,拾起技术,还能找工作。
就业:在大三的时候加深技术,再去找实习。

专科一定要专升本。

小结

小编认为考研,还是要认清楚自己的实力。

英语怎么样?数学怎么样?学了这么多年了都没学好,冲一年多就行了?

如果觉得考不上就不浪费时间考了。就业可以投递几百家,而考研就只能考一所学校。

如果你想考,同时有把握考的上,可以考!

青春由磨砺而出彩,人生因奋斗而升华!

相关推荐
默心3 分钟前
Jenkins与Maven的集成配置
运维·ci/cd·jenkins·maven·devops
编程大全5 分钟前
47道ES67高频题整理(附答案背诵版)
开发语言·javascript·ecmascript
荔枝吻11 分钟前
【沉浸式解决问题】System.getProperty(“user.dir“)获取不到项目根目录
java·bug
不二狗12 分钟前
每日算法 -【Swift 算法】不含重复字符的最长子串:暴力解法 vs 滑动窗口
开发语言·算法·swift
小五Z18 分钟前
Redis应用--缓存
开发语言·数据库·redis·缓存
七刀26 分钟前
5G-A和未来6G技术下的操作系统与移动设备变革:云端化与轻量化的发展趋势
开发语言·php
白总Server27 分钟前
CAP分布式理论
java·linux·运维·服务器·开发语言·分布式·数据库架构
豆沙沙包?28 分钟前
2025年- H42-Lc150 --146. LRU缓存(哈希表,双链表)需二刷--Java版
java·缓存·散列表
Uranus^28 分钟前
深入解析Spring Boot与Redis集成:高效缓存与性能优化
java·spring boot·redis·缓存·性能优化
码农爱java30 分钟前
Java 调用 GitLab API
java·开发语言·后端·gitlab·gitapi